This book is a highlight of my best poems and a few new ones, I provide you with my study of society mixed with some fantasy and humor. It is my aim to leave my work to my children as a legacy to remember me as a poet and writer of novels as well as a qualified nurse. My children are aware of this as I have discussed with each of them namely Gemma, Jennifer, Michael, and Daniel Sutton my intentions after my death. This is my fifth book of poems that began in 1988 and continues to this day, this book is a compilation of my favorite work. My poet’s corner is an Avon for all poets to share their work, so, come and join me. There are over seventy poems in this book to enjoy which are all aspects of my life.
The poems are written to inspire people to think about life and events throughout life that had an impact on society, I also introduce humor into some poems demonstrating my versatility as a writer, my poems are easy to read and be understood by most people in order that the reader gets the benefit out of reading them.
